Nutfield is a locality in Victoria, Australia, 30 km north-east of Melbourne's Central Business District, located within the Shire of Nillumbik local government area. Nutfield recorded a population of 158 at the 2021 census.
Nutfield Post Office opened around October 1911 and closed in 1964. [2]
